Description
What It Is:
This is a place value worksheet. It asks students to decompose two-digit numbers into tens and ones. For example, the worksheet shows '97 = tens + ones'. The worksheet contains a series of similar problems using various two-digit numbers.
Grade Level Suitability:
This worksheet is suitable for 1st and 2nd grade. It focuses on basic place value concepts, which are typically introduced in these grades. It reinforces understanding of tens and ones in two-digit numbers.
Why Use It:
This worksheet helps students practice and reinforce their understanding of place value. It provides a visual way to break down numbers into their component parts (tens and ones). This supports number sense and lays the foundation for more complex math concepts.
How to Use It:
Students should write the number of tens and ones for each given two-digit number in the provided blanks. For example, for '97 = tens + ones', they would write '9' in the first blank and '7' in the second blank.
Target Users:
The target users are 1st and 2nd grade students who are learning about place value. It's also beneficial for students who need extra practice or review in this area. Teachers and parents can use it as a supplemental learning tool.
